Nothing has worked so far today for Georgia Tech. The defense was gashed by the Duke offense for two touchdowns, and a punt return took the Blue Devils to the 1-yard line for an easy third touchdown. The offense has sputtered on third down and in general, only finding much success in the passing game, strangely, where Justin Thomas is 4-for-6 with 92 yards. The Jackets finally put together a nice drive before halftime, resulting in a touchdown pass to Ricky Jeune.
The defense seemed to start extremely slowly before tightening up a bit in the second quarter. Duke has over 200 yards in the first half and have over 100 yards of passing and rushing. The defense forced a turnover on the first drive of the game, as Duke was slashing for 8 yards per play prior to that.
